Description
The
Curves CompressionSpring tool creates a compression spring.
Usage
- There are several ways to invoke the tool:
- Press the
Compression Spring button.
- Select the Surfaces →
Compression Spring option from the menu.
- A CompSpring object is created showing the spine (wire) only.
- Optionally edit the values in the Property editor to display the solid shape and adjust the related properties (see Properties below).
Properties
See also: Property editor.
A CompSpring object is derived from a Part Feature object and inherits all its properties. It also has the following additional properties:
Data
Comp Spring
- DataDiameter (
Float): Diameter of the spring.
- DataLength (
Float): Spring Length.
- DataReverse Helix (
Bool): Left hand if true.
- DataTurns (
Integer): Number of turns.
- DataWire Diameter (
Float): Diameter of the spring wire.
Setting
- DataFlatness (
Integer): Flatness of spring extremities from 0 to 4.
- DataWire Output (
Bool): Output a wire shape.
